  • Abstract
    This paper presents results from our studies of 15 ohm and 30 ohm tapered MILOs; it will describe some of the technical challenges faced and their resolution, and conclude with an outline of potential future developments. Tapered MILOs are variants of the magnetically insulated line oscillator (MILO) which use novel tapered slow-wave structure, diode layout and axial power extraction. They produce long pulses at power levels of several gigawatts and with frequencies up to several GHz.
